Decision expected by 17 September 2026, 8 weeks from validation under the statutory target for most applications. Extensions of time are common and are agreed case by case.
Ashford took a median of 60 days over the applications it decided in the last year.

About heritage and listed building applications
Listed building consent is needed for works that affect the special interest of a listed building, and carrying out such works without it is a criminal offence. More in our guide to planning application types.
